A steel bar 7 cm long is welded end to end to a copper bar 3 cm long. Each bar has a square cross section 2.00 cm on a side. The free end of the steel with a temprature at 84 °C, and the free end of the cooper bar is at 12 °C. Find the total rate of heat flow in (W)? (ksteel =50.2 W/K.m and kcopper =385 W/K.m ) (Answer in one decimal places) Material having thermal conductivity k Area A Steel Соpper
